Greece is a mainland-island country where almost all types of gambling are permitted. The first land-based gambling establishment opened its doors back in the 20th century. Today, the gambling industry in Greece is represented by 9 offline venues and a vast online market. Legalized online casinos use national Greek domain names *.gr. Virtual sports betting in casinos is prohibited. An online gambling license is issued for a single resource, with no right to transfer or lease it.

Although the transitional period has ended, no online operator licenses have been issued in Greece yet.
Gambling websites in Greece are connected to the Supervision and Control IT System (PSEE), which helps the regulator monitor and control gambling processes.
The control of online casinos by EEEP includes:
-
Compliance by licensees with the procedure for registering and identifying users, obligations, and regulations protecting player rights in online casinos.
-
Licensing, purchasing, installation, and operation of technical equipment and software for conducting gambling activities.
-
Supervision of table (roulette or blackjack) and electronic gambling (slot machines).
-
Submission of written instructions for gambling operations, suitability of technical equipment or materials.
-
Acceptance, evaluation, and processing of complaints and suggestions from players.
Online gambling licenses are issued by the Minister of Finance for a period of 5 years following the review of tender applications. If an application is rejected, a new one can be submitted only after one year. The operator must use certified software from legal suppliers.
The law prohibits licensees from providing services to players under 21 years of age. Operators are required to create an individual account for each player. Personal data, an account number from a financial institution registered in Greece and operating under its laws, must be provided.
The visitor identification procedure includes registration (or the presence) of a player card and checking for inclusion in the Self-excluded player list.
Before creating an account in an online gambling establishment, users must agree to the conditions for processing personal information (document in Greek).
Legal Types of Gambling Entertainment in Greece
The gambling law in Greece permits the following forms of entertainment: sports betting, casino games (blackjack, poker, etc.), slot machines, and other gaming devices, gaming terminals, bingo, and lotteries. Users can enjoy these forms of gambling only in licensed establishments. Violation of the law can lead to criminal liability (imprisonment). Strict conditions are in place to combat illegal bookmakers and casinos. Authorities attempt to close not only land-based offices but also block offshore portals. As a result, many foreign websites are inaccessible from Greek IP addresses. However, using special services, it is possible to bypass these restrictions quickly.

Technical Support for Online Casino Users and Gamblers in Greece
Online casinos are required to provide information about the dangers of gambling addiction, materials for checking signs of gambling disorder, and contact information for state programs offering assistance to users.
A platform called e-ASSOS has been created based on the Commission, which includes information and applications to inform online players: multimedia materials, printed forms, self-assessment questionnaires.

The exclusion period is at least 6 months. During this period, the player’s accounts in online establishments in the country are blocked. If the player personally submits a request to be included in the Self-excluded players list, they can revoke it within 24 hours.
Qualified medical assistance can be obtained at centers operating under the KETHEA program.
